Red River Bancshares, Inc. (RRBI) is a US stock in Financial Services. The latest InvestLog snapshot shows $95.78 with -0.14% on the session and $630.6M in market capitalization; recent performance reads 1-month +0.58% and YTD +24.32%.
The latest financial table shown here is Q1 2026, with revenue of $43.7M, net income of $12.0M, and EPS of $1.81. Investors can compare that operating picture with valuation signals such as P/E 14.02 and FCF yield 7.4%.

Red River Bancshares, Inc. serves as the parent organization for Red River Bank, delivering a full suite of banking products and services to both businesses and individual clients across Louisiana. The bank offers a variety of deposit options, including checking, savings, and money market accounts, as well as time deposits. Its lending portfolio is comprehensive, encompassing commercial real estate financing, construction and development loans, and commercial and industrial credit facilities – including those previously offered under the Small Business Administration's Paycheck Protection Program. For individuals, the bank provides one-to-four family residential mortgages, home equity lines of credit, and diverse consumer loans tailored for personal, family, and household expenses, available as secured or unsecured installment and term options. Additionally, Red River Bank extends tax-exempt loans, lines of credit, and standby letters of credit. Beyond lending and deposit services, the company offers treasury management, private banking, and brokerage solutions. Customers can also access investment advisory, financial planning, and a range of retirement plans. Day-to-day financial needs are supported by debit and credit cards, direct deposits, cashier's checks, and wire transfer capabilities. Modern banking is facilitated through comprehensive online services, enabling account monitoring, fund transfers, bill payments, and digital statement delivery. Accessibility is ensured via multiple channels, including in-person visits to banking centers, ATMs, drive-through facilities, night deposits, telephone, mail, mobile banking, and remote deposit capture. The company operates a network of 27 banking centers throughout Louisiana, complemented by two combined loan and deposit production offices located in Lafayette and New Orleans. Red River Bancshares, Inc. was established in 1998 and maintains its headquarters in Alexandria, Louisiana.
